On Sunday, Rep. John Yarmuth, D-Ky., called for a ban on teenagers wearing “Make America Great Again” hats, claiming the hats are “poisoning young minds.”
“I am calling for a total and complete shutdown of teenagers wearing MAGA hats until we can figure out what is going on. They seem to be poisoning young minds,” he said without providing any proof of his insane assertion. “The conduct we saw in this video is beyond appalling, but it didn’t happen in a vacuum. This is a direct result of the racist hatred displayed daily by the President of the United States who, sadly, some mistake for a role model,” he said in another tweet, referring to a report that said a Native American leader was surrounded and taunted by pro-life Covington Catholic students.
